96SEO 2026-02-20 05:44 0
。

LNMP是一个缩写词#xff0c;具体包括Linux操作系统、nginx网站服务器、MySQL数据库服务器、PHP#xff08;或…一、LNMP
LNMP架构是目前成熟的企业网站应用模式之一指的是协同工作的一整套系统和相关软件
能够提供动态Web站点服务及其应用开发环境。
LNMP是一个缩写词具体包括Linux操作系统、nginx网站服务器、MySQL数据库服务器、PHP或Perl、Python网页编程语言。
L(平台)Linux作为LNMP架构的基础提供用于支撑Web站点的操作系统
能够与其他三个组件提供更好的稳定性兼容性(NMP组件也支持Windows、UNIX等平台)。
N(前台)nginxnginx网站服务提供前端的静态页面服务。
同时具有代理转发作用。
转发后端请求转发PHPnginx没有处理动态资源的功能但是有可以支持转发动态请求的模块。
M(后台)MySQLMySQL关系型数据库保存用户的账号和密码P(中间连接)PHP动态页面的编程语言负责解释动态网页文件和nginx以及数据库协同
--with-http_stub_status_module1.5
/lib/systemd/system/nginx.service
#定义服务单元所依赖的其他单元这里表示服务需要在网络加载完成之后启动
#指定服务的类型这里是forking表示服务是一个后台进程通常是fork出子进程
PIDFile/usr/local/nginx/logs/nginx.pid
#指定保存主进程ID的文件路径Nginx将会把主进程ID写入这个文件以便Systemd可以追踪和管理进程
ExecStart/usr/local/nginx/sbin/nginx
#指定启动服务的命令。
这里是启动Nginx的命令/usr/local/nginx/sbin/nginx
#指定重新加载配置的命令。
当执行此命令时Systemd将发送HUP信号给主进程Nginx将重新加载配置文件
#指定停止服务的命令。
当执行此命令时Systemd将发送QUIT信号给主进程Nginx将优雅地停止服务
#指定服务所属的目标target这里是multi-user.target表示服务在多用户模式下启动
/lib/systemd/system/nginx.service1.9
-DCMAKE_INSTALL_PREFIX/usr/local/mysql
-DMYSQL_UNIX_ADDR/usr/local/mysql/mysql.sock
-DSYSTEMD_PID_DIR/usr/local/mysql
-DDEFAULT_COLLATIONutf8_general_ci
-DWITH_INNOBASE_STORAGE_ENGINE1
-DWITH_BLACKHOLE_STORAGE_ENGINE1
-DWITH_PERFSCHEMA_STORAGE_ENGINE1
-DMYSQL_DATADIR/usr/local/mysql/data
socket/usr/local/mysql/mysql.sock
socket文件路径默认为/tmp/mysql.sock。
在该配置文件中指定的路径是/usr/local/mysql/mysql.sock[mysqld]
#MySQL服务器使用的默认字符集这里设置为UTF-8编码utf8
#保存MySQL服务器进程ID的文件路径默认为/var/run/mysqld/mysqld.pid。
在该配置文件中指定的路径是/usr/local/mysql/mysqld.pid
socket/usr/local/mysql/mysql.sock
socket文件路径默认为/tmp/mysql.sock。
在该配置文件中指定的路径是/usr/local/mysql/mysql.sock
#MySQL服务器绑定的IP地址默认为127.0.0.1这里设置为0.0.0.0表示允许任何IP地址访问MySQL服务器
#MySQL服务器支持的最大并发连接数默认为151这里设置为2048
#设置MySQL服务器接收的最大数据包大小默认为4MB这里设置为16MB
#设置MySQL服务器的唯一ID在主从复制设置中使用sql_modeNO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_AUTO_VALUE_ON_ZERO,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,PIPES_AS_CONCAT,ANSI_QUOTES2.7
PATH/usr/local/mysql/bin:/usr/local/mysql/lib:$PATH
--datadir/usr/local/mysql/data2.10
/usr/local/mysql/usr/lib/systemd/system/mysqld.service
#授予root用户可以在所有终端远程登录使用的密码是123456并对所有数据库和所有表有操作权限flush
--with-mysql-sock/usr/local/mysql/mysql.sock
/opt/php-7.1.10/php.ini-development
/usr/lib/systemd/system/php-fpm.service
/usr/local/nginx/conf/nginx.conf
/usr/local/nginx/html$fastcgi_script_name;
$document_root$fastcgi_script_name;
/usr/local/nginx/html/index.php
http://192.168.247.30/index.php3.12
表示授予所有权限包括SELECT、INSERT、UPDATE、DELETE、CREATE、DROP等。
#因此这个语句授予bbsuser用户在bbs数据库的所有表上的所有权限。
这是授予权限的用户和主机的标识。
bbsuser是用户名%表示任何主机。
这是设置bbsuser用户的密码为admin123这样用户在连接时需要提供相应的密码。
GRANT
#这条语句与第一条类似但是主机部分不同。
bbsuserlocalhost表示用户bbsuser只能从本地主机即MySQL服务器所在的主机连接并拥有相同的权限。
#bbsuser用户被授予在bbs数据库的全部权限允许从任何主机和本地主机连接MySQL服务器并且密码为admin123.flush
/usr/local/nginx/html/index.php
$linkmysqli_connect(192.168.247.10,bbsuser,admin123);
#使用mysqli_connect()函数连接到MySQL数据库服务器。
#192.168.247.10表示MySQL服务器的IP地址。
#如果连接成功即$link不为空就输出h1Success!!/h1显示Success!!这个标题。
#如果连接失败即$link为空就输出Fail!!显示Fail!!这个信息。
浏览器访问
http://192.168.247.30/index.php
/usr/local/nginx/html/bbs/#调整论坛目录的权限
http://192.168.247.10/bbs/install/index.php
作为专业的SEO优化服务提供商,我们致力于通过科学、系统的搜索引擎优化策略,帮助企业在百度、Google等搜索引擎中获得更高的排名和流量。我们的服务涵盖网站结构优化、内容优化、技术SEO和链接建设等多个维度。
| 服务项目 | 基础套餐 | 标准套餐 | 高级定制 |
|---|---|---|---|
| 关键词优化数量 | 10-20个核心词 | 30-50个核心词+长尾词 | 80-150个全方位覆盖 |
| 内容优化 | 基础页面优化 | 全站内容优化+每月5篇原创 | 个性化内容策略+每月15篇原创 |
| 技术SEO | 基本技术检查 | 全面技术优化+移动适配 | 深度技术重构+性能优化 |
| 外链建设 | 每月5-10条 | 每月20-30条高质量外链 | 每月50+条多渠道外链 |
| 数据报告 | 月度基础报告 | 双周详细报告+分析 | 每周深度报告+策略调整 |
| 效果保障 | 3-6个月见效 | 2-4个月见效 | 1-3个月快速见效 |
我们的SEO优化服务遵循科学严谨的流程,确保每一步都基于数据分析和行业最佳实践:
全面检测网站技术问题、内容质量、竞争对手情况,制定个性化优化方案。
基于用户搜索意图和商业目标,制定全面的关键词矩阵和布局策略。
解决网站技术问题,优化网站结构,提升页面速度和移动端体验。
创作高质量原创内容,优化现有页面,建立内容更新机制。
获取高质量外部链接,建立品牌在线影响力,提升网站权威度。
持续监控排名、流量和转化数据,根据效果调整优化策略。
基于我们服务的客户数据统计,平均优化效果如下:
我们坚信,真正的SEO优化不仅仅是追求排名,而是通过提供优质内容、优化用户体验、建立网站权威,最终实现可持续的业务增长。我们的目标是与客户建立长期合作关系,共同成长。
Demand feedback